Science: Bing Chat and "No-Search" Feature

Bing Chat, a part of Microsoft's Bing search engine, is introducing a "No-Search" feature that allows users to disable Bing Chat's connection to search the web for answers. While this feature might not seem groundbreaking at first, it has significant implications for scientific applications.

For example, in the fields of mathematics and computer programming, users can ask Bing Chat specific questions without the distraction of web search results. This feature is particularly useful for tasks that require focused problem-solving, such as debugging code or solving complex mathematical problems. Moreover, Bing Chat's "No-Search" feature is not only limited to technical questions but also extends to casual conversations, enhancing user experience.
